    Have you already checked readme_5626 (release notes for the latest DSS V6 build)?

    --------------------from readme 5626-----------------------------------
    In order to install the software on separate LUN, please use RAID controllers with multiple LUN support. Please create a small 2GB logical unit for DSS V6.
    When Running DSS V6 installer you will need to select the 2GB logical unit as the boot media.
    The rest of the RAID space please create second LUN for the user data.
    The following RAID controllers are supported as a bootable media:
    MegaRAID, Smart Array, 3ware, Adaptec, ICP vortex, Areca.
    For Smart Array please use the RAID management CD as the RAID BIOS does not support LUN management.
    -----------------------------------------------------------------------

    DSS V6 can be installed either on H/W RAID unit or on usb memory stick.
    If you install it on a hard drive it will reserve the whole drive and it won't be possible to use the free space for volume group.

    Only trail and full versions of DSS V6 supports H/W RAIDs, DSS V6 Lite version doesn't:
